"Great location and a very nice staff. Cute boutique hotel. The room is nice and the bed is comfy. Be prepared to pay $60 per night for valet parking at the hotel...which is steep. The sign outside the hotel notes $50 for parking however they add 20% tax on top of that, which is extreme and likely not passed on to the valet as a tip, so you tip..on top of that too. If you only travel with an overnight bag, it's definitely worth finding another garage/lot in the area, which would save you some money. Lastly, housekeeping was fine, room was clean, however they should leave an extra roll of TP as you are only left with, whatever was already on the roll. If you run out, you are literally SOL. So they need to either provide a fresh roll, or at the least leave an extra roll. Paying 20% taxes on parking, I shouldn't feel like the TP is being rationed out, nor should a guest have to ask for more as I overheard another guest do. Overall, great stay, not a deal breaker. When you know better you do better. I know better about the parking."

This screw-pile lighthouse, one of the oldest Chesapeake lighthouses still in existence, features fascinating museum exhibits and views over Baltimore’s harbor.
